PACB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2017 in Review

106 of the 4,017 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Pacific Biosciences (PACB) for Q1 2017, worth a combined $406M — up 69% from $240M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 22 funds closed out of PACB and 19 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 33 trimmed existing stakes and 32 added.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$38.5M. The largest seller was UBS Group, cutting an estimated $28M.
